So was this the Lightning setup to the factory y connection or the performance connect to the SW headers?
I have the Headers with performance connect lightning and while it did not fall off with the offroading I have done in the truck I did take it to an exhaust shop and have them weld hangers on both ends of the muffler to the frame and its rock solid now. With out the extra hangers it moved even when driving on the street and off road I was just waiting to tear the single hanger it was using.
